Yeah brain plasticity is an amazing phenomenon which is a major factor in our being able learn and adapt to many environments over the eons and allows us to recover from traumatic brain injury or disease.
While this is a great thing, there is a down side too. Brain plasticity is also plays a key role in drug addiction. This page about brain plasticity (http://www.brainhealthandpuzzles.com/brain_plasticity.html) talks about both the good and bad.
